    Pelvic spurs (also known as vestigial legs) are external protrusions found around the cloaca in certain superfamilies of snakes belonging to the greater infraorder Alethinophidia. [1] These spurs are made up of the remnants of the femur bone, which is then covered by a corneal spur, or claw-like structure. [ 1 ]

    The term spur is sometimes used to describe the pelvic spur, vestigial limbs found in primitive snakes, such as boas and pythons and in the striped legless lizard. [3] [4] The spurs primarily serve as holdfasts during mating. As these form at the terminal end of the limb, they may properly be claws rather than true spurs.

    [10]: 11 [11] Pythons and boas—primitive groups among modern snakes—have vestigial hind limbs: tiny, clawed digits known as anal spurs, which are used to grasp during mating. [ 10 ] : 11 [ 12 ] The Leptotyphlopidae and Typhlopidae groups also possess remnants of the pelvic girdle, sometimes appearing as horny projections when visible.
